The success Leipzig have enjoyed this season has not gone unnoticed, much like the strong performances of Dayot Upamecano. At 21 years old the centre-back whose pace rivals him with the quickest attackers, is defending well. Standing tall at 6ft 1, his passing abilities are characteristic of a player who worked as a forward and a midfielder at his first professional club, Valenciennes. The youngster has drawn comparisons to Marcel Desailly, because of their similar traits like strength and speed. Many in France feel it is only a matter of time before he breaks into the senior national squad.

Chelsea right-back Reece James has looked completely unfazed this season. The transfer ban in Summer 2019, has arguably been a blessing in disguise with Chelsea manager Frank Lampard, unafraid to start the younger players. James is one player who has come into his role and excelled. A threat going forward with his crosses but also sound defensively. Loan-technical coach and Chelsea legend Paulo Ferreira, has described him as someone who is easy to work with and always willing to learn. At 19 years old he plays with experience, and is maturing as the season goes on.

At just 17 years old, Eduardo Camavinga has emerged as one of the best young midfielders in Europe. Composed on the ball, Camavinga has produced man of the match displays against Marseille and PSG, which has alerted the likes of Real Madrid and Arsenal. The holding midfielder role is where Camavinga has generally operated this season, but his manager Julien Stephan has played him further forward. Stephan believes that Camavinga has the skill set to play in both positions. A frequent starter for Stade Rennais, the Angola-born youngster has shown a level of maturity that will only serve him well for the future.

Alphonso Davies has been a constant threat for Bayern Munich this season. His transition to left-back has been smooth, and the pace Davies delivers on the left-flank for Bayern gives them a different attacking dimension. The width he provides allows midfield players like Thiago Alcantara, to have more time and space. Interim coach Hanzi Flick has full confidence in the young Canadian, and described him as a great passer of the ball. The 19 year old’s development is ongoing and his strength in both attacking and defending, has bolstered Bayern’s chances of winning yet another Bundesliga title.

Young midfielder Sandro Tonali is currently flourishing in the Serie A this season. The 19 year old has drawn comparisons to Andrea Pirlo, whose career also started at Brescia. Tonali was a key player in Brescia’s promotion campaign last season, and his impressive performances have continued this term. The passing ability Tonali possesses allows him to dictate play, which is similar to Pirlo. However, whilst the teenager acknowledges the similarities with Pirlo, it is Gennaro Gattuso who he believes he shares more qualities with, because of the more robust side to his game.

Valverde, now 21 years old, is a crucial part of Real Madrid’s midfield and his manager Zinedine Zidane has been pleased with the performances. The box-to-box style of the young Uruguayan allows him to press opponents higher up the field, and track back to help defend. The nickname, “El Pajarito” or “The Little Bird” was given to Valverde when he was younger, because of his ability to fly around the pitch. This season revealed how “The Little Bird” has become a tyrant, and a main protagonist in Real Madrid’s pursuit of La Liga.

The work of Arsenal youngsters Bukayo Saka and Gabriel Martinelli down the left-hand side has been one of this season’s successes. The two youngsters, both 18 years old, have developed a partnership that compliments their own playing styles. Saka has adjusted well at left back, and has been able to score and provide an assist in 3 separate matches. Martinelli’s enthusiasm is evident and his composure in front of goal is unerring. He has become the first teenager since Nicolas Anelka to score 10 goals for Arsenal in a season. The progress of Saka and Martinelli has been a shining light in a disappointing campaign for Arsenal.

Erling Haaland and Jadon Sancho, both 19 years old, are in scintillating form in the Bundesliga. Whether scoring goals or registering assists, this special pairing is breaking records in the process. Haaland became the first player in Bundesliga history to score 7 goals in 3 games whereas Sancho was the first teenager to score 25 Bundesliga goals. Although inexperienced, Dortmund’s trust in Haaland and Sancho has given them a platform to play with freedom. This is a factor that has pleased the Dortmund faithful, whose expectations have been exceeded by the two youngsters.
